How long does marijuana stay in your body

How long does marijuana stay in your body

Marijuana, or cannabis, is a psychoactive substance that can remain in the human body long after its effects have worn off. The duration for which marijuana stays in the body depends on several factors, including the frequency of use, the individual’s metabolism, the potency of the product, body fat percentage, and the kind of drug test that was conducted.


1. How Marijuana Is Metabolized

When marijuana is consumed whether through smoking, vaping, or ingesting edibles the active compound responsible for its psychoactive effects, tetrahydrocannabinol (THC), enters the bloodstream. Once in the bloodstream, THC is quickly distributed to various tissues and organs, including the brain, where it produces its characteristic effects (e.g., euphoria, altered perception, increased appetite).

THC is lipophilic, meaning it binds readily to fat molecules. This causes it to accumulate in fatty tissues and be released slowly over time. The liver metabolizes THC into several compounds, the most notable being 11-hydroxy-THC (also psychoactive) and eventually into the non-psychoactive metabolite THC-COOH, which is commonly measured in drug tests.


2. Factors Influencing How Long Marijuana Stays in the Body
a. Frequency and Duration of Use
  • Occasional users (once every few weeks): THC metabolites may be detectable for 1–3 days.
  • Moderate users (several times per week): Detection window extends to 7–10 days.
  • Chronic users (daily or near-daily): THC can linger in the system for 3–4 weeks or longer.
  • Heavy chronic users (multiple times daily): Detection is possible for up to 60+ days in extreme cases.
b. Method of Consumption

  • Inhalation (smoking or vaping): THC enters the bloodstream quickly, peaks within minutes, and declines rapidly. However, metabolites remain for days to weeks.
  • Oral ingestion (edibles): Slower onset but prolonged duration of THC and metabolites in the bloodstream due to first-pass metabolism in the liver.
c. Metabolism and Body Composition
  • THC may be cleared faster by people with quicker metabolisms.
  • Higher body fat means more storage for THC, prolonging its presence.
  • Liver function also affects how efficiently THC is broken down and excreted.
d. Potency of the Marijuana Product
  • High-THC strains or concentrates introduce more THC into the system, increasing the load for metabolism and extending the clearance time.

3. Detection Windows by Drug Test Type

Different types of drug tests vary in their sensitivity and detection windows. Here’s how they compare:

a. Urine Tests

Urinalysis is the most common method for marijuana detection, especially in workplace drug testing.

User TypeDetection Window
OccasionalUp to 3 days
ModerateUp to 7–10 days
ChronicUp to 30 days
Heavy chronic30–60+ days

Urine tests detect THC-COOH, not active THC. This means the test reveals past use, not current intoxication.

b. Blood Tests

Blood tests are usually reserved for accident investigations, DUI cases, or emergency diagnostics due to their narrow detection window and invasiveness.

User TypeDetection Window
Occasional1–2 days
ChronicUp to 7 days

Blood tests can detect both THC and THC-COOH. However, active THC is typically only present for a few hours post-consumption unless the individual is a heavy user.

c. Saliva Tests

Saliva testing is growing in popularity due to its non-invasive nature and real-time detection capability.

User TypeDetection Window
Occasional24–48 hours
ChronicUp to 72 hours

THC is detectable in saliva primarily because it coats the mouth’s mucosal surfaces during use.

d. Hair Tests

Hair follicle testing provides the longest detection window and is often used in pre-employment or forensic settings.

User TypeDetection Window
Any useUp to 90 days

Hair testing looks for THC metabolites incorporated into the hair shaft as it grows, offering a long retrospective view of drug use. It typically requires at least 1.5 inches of hair from the scalp.


4. Breakdown of THC Elimination Process

Once THC enters the system, the body eliminates it in stages:

  1. Distribution Phase (Minutes to Hours)
    THC distributes rapidly to the brain and organs, producing psychoactive effects within minutes (inhalation) or 30–90 minutes (edibles).
  2. Metabolic Phase (Hours to Days)
    THC is broken down primarily in the liver via cytochrome P450 enzymes into 11-hydroxy-THC and then into THC-COOH.
  3. Elimination Phase (Days to Weeks)
    Metabolites are excreted in urine (primarily), feces, and sweat. Due to THC’s lipophilicity, this process can be slow, especially for regular users.

5. Strategies and Myths Around Detoxification
a. Hydration and Diuretics

Drinking large amounts of water may dilute urine, which could lower metabolite concentrations. However, labs can detect over-dilution and may flag such samples as suspicious or invalid.

b. Exercise

Burning fat can release stored THC into the bloodstream, temporarily increasing detectable levels. While regular exercise might help reduce body fat over time, it’s not a guaranteed detox strategy just before a test.

c. Commercial Detox Products

Many detox kits claim to flush THC from the body, but scientific evidence supporting their efficacy is limited. Some may temporarily mask metabolites, but they do not accelerate THC metabolism.

d. Time

Ultimately, time is the most reliable way to clear THC from the system. The duration depends on the user’s pattern of consumption and biological factors.

7. Conclusion

Marijuana can remain in the body for days to several weeks depending on usage frequency, body composition, and the type of test used. Urine tests are the most widely used and can detect use in chronic users up to a month or more after the last dose. Blood and saliva tests detect more recent use, while hair testing can reveal usage from months prior.

Understanding how long marijuana stays in the system is crucial for users in regulated environments or those subject to drug testing. While hydration, exercise, and detox kits may offer marginal help, the only surefire method of clearing THC is allowing sufficient time for the body to metabolize and eliminate it naturally.
